ILLGrenoble / ngx-remote-desktop

Angular component for accessing remote desktops using guacamole
https://illgrenoble.github.io/ngx-remote-desktop/
MIT License
35 stars 38 forks source link

npm start fail #16

Open MUYUSY opened 4 years ago

MUYUSY commented 4 years ago

Project is running at http://localhost:9999/ webpack output is served from /

[at-loader] Using typescript@2.9.2 from typescript and "tsconfig.json" from D:/code/ngx-remote-desktop-master/tsconfig.json (in a forked process).

[at-loader]: Child process failed to process the request: TypeError: Cannot read property 'getEntryByPath' of undefined at Object.fileExists (D:\code\ngx-remote-desktop-master\node_modules\typescript\lib\typescript.js:107655:39) at Object.fileExists (D:\code\ngx-remote-desktop-master\node_modules\typescript\lib\typescript.js:78971:791) at getDirectoryOrExtensionlessFileName (D:\code\ngx-remote-desktop-master\node_modules\typescript\lib\typescript.js:81877:26) at tryGetModuleNameAsNodeModule (D:\code\ngx-remote-desktop-master\node_modules\typescript\lib\typescript.js:81868:35) at getGlobalModuleSpecifier (D:\code\ngx-remote-desktop-master\node_modules\typescript\lib\typescript.js:81672:20) at D:\code\ngx-remote-desktop-master\node_modules\typescript\lib\typescript.js:81655:88 at Object.mapDefined (D:\code\ngx-remote-desktop-master\node_modules\typescript\lib\typescript.js:2172:30) at Object.getModuleSpecifiers (D:\code\ngx-remote-desktop-master\node_modules\typescript\lib\typescript.js:81655:29) at getNameOfSymbolAsWritten (D:\code\ngx-remote-desktop-master\node_modules\typescript\lib\typescript.js:30239:81) at symbolToTypeNode (D:\code\ngx-remote-desktop-master\node_modules\typescript\lib\typescript.js:30009:32) (node:17256) DeprecationWarning: Chunk.modules is deprecated. Use Chunk.getNumberOfModules/mapModules/forEachModule/containsModule instead.

ERROR in ./demo/app/app.component.ts Module build failed: Error: Final loader didn't return a Buffer or String at D:\code\ngx-remote-desktop-master\node_modules\webpack\lib\NormalModule.js:204:46 at D:\code\ngx-remote-desktop-master\node_modules\loader-runner\lib\LoaderRunner.js:373:3 at iterateNormalLoaders (D:\code\ngx-remote-desktop-master\node_modules\loader-runner\lib\LoaderRunner.js:214:10) at iterateNormalLoaders (D:\code\ngx-remote-desktop-master\node_modules\loader-runner\lib\LoaderRunner.js:221:10) at D:\code\ngx-remote-desktop-master\node_modules\loader-runner\lib\LoaderRunner.js:236:3 at context.callback (D:\code\ngx-remote-desktop-master\node_modules\loader-runner\lib\LoaderRunner.js:111:13) at runMicrotasks () at processTicksAndRejections (internal/process/task_queues.js:93:5) @ ./demo/app/app.module.ts 11:22-48 @ ./demo/bootstrap.ts @ multi (webpack)-dev-server/client?http://localhost:9999 ./demo/bootstrap.ts webpack: Failed to compile.

anyone face the same problem? how to fix it.

mmeguizodkm commented 2 years ago

https://timjames.me/blog/2017/04/03/webpack-final-loader-didnt-return-a-buffer-or-string/

ichange the tsconfig and it works

"awesomeTypescriptLoaderOptions": { "useWebpackText": true, "useTranspileModule": true, "doTypeCheck": true, "forkChecker": true }